Sorts Of Stress Washing Machines
When it involves press washing, recognizing the different kinds of pressure washers offered can make a substantial difference in your cleaning efficiency.
You'll typically encounter three major kinds: electrical, gas, and hot water pressure washers.
Electric pressure washing machines are ideal for light-duty tasks, such as washing cars and trucks or cleaning up patio areas. They're quieter, simpler to make use of, and excellent for smaller sized work around your home.
If you need more power for harder work, gas stress washers are the way to go. They're extra powerful and can manage heavy-duty tasks like stripping paint or cleansing huge driveways. However, they need more maintenance and can be a bit louder.
For those truly tough tasks, hot water pressure washers supply the best cleaning power. They warm the water, making it efficient for removing oil and oil stains. These are generally used in business setups but can be valuable for residential individuals dealing with challenging cleansing tasks.
Picking the appropriate type of stress washer for your demands will help you conserve time and effort, guaranteeing you do the job properly.
Safety Measures
Before diving right into your pressure cleaning job, it's important to prioritize safety preventative measures to protect on your own and your surroundings. First, use proper gear, consisting of safety and security goggles, gloves, and non-slip shoes. These things will certainly protect you from debris and high-pressure water.
Next, be mindful of your equipment. Inspect the stress washing machine for any type of leakages or damages before usage. Ensure all connections are tight, and always comply with the producer's directions regarding operation and maintenance.
When dealing with chemicals, ensure you're in a well-ventilated area and wear a mask to prevent breathing in damaging fumes. Maintain a first aid kit nearby for any minor injuries that may take place throughout the project.
Keep in mind to preserve a secure range from electric outlets, power lines, and other prospective threats. Beware of unsafe surfaces, particularly when making use of water on walkways or driveways.
Ultimately, avoid aiming the nozzle at individuals, pet dogs, or fragile surface areas. By following these safety precautions, you'll create a much safer work environment and decrease the danger of crashes or injuries while pressure washing.
Remain alert, and do not rush your job!
